Here is what your next 90 days should look like:
Month 1: Audit & Align
Identify every AI tool, automation, or vendor in your stack.
Ask: What problem is this solving today?
Meet with operations, compliance, and clinical leads to ensure alignment with trial priorities.
Tip: Do not let data science teams run AI in a silo. It is imperative to pull clinical, regulatory, and finance into the loop—now.
Month 2: Educate & Pilot with Purpose
Launch internal training on AI literacy for cross-functional teams.
Choose one use case (e.g., protocol optimization or site feasibility) to pilot.
Define measurable success metrics—don’t fall into the “we will know it when we see it” trap.
Tip: If it cannot be validated, explained, or scaled, it’s not ready for prime time.
Month 3: Document & Defend
Document workflows and decisions for every AI-enhanced process.
Prepare for regulatory scrutiny: who reviewed the model, how were deviations handled, how is human oversight built in?
Begin building your AI audit trail—your future FDA reviewers will thank you.
Tip: Treat your AI tools like you treat your lab assays—standardize, validate, and own the results.
What is the bottom line? We do not need more AI promises—we need operational clarity, cross-functional trust, and systems that scale.
